Impasse
An impasse is a situation in which one or both parties believe that reaching an agreement is not imminent.
Negative Settlement Zone
Negative Settlement Zone refers to a situation in negotiation where the interests of the parties involved do not overlap, making it hard to find a satisfactory agreement for both.
Negotiation Process
A series of discussions and compromises between two or more parties to reach a mutually acceptable agreement.
Bargaining Zone
The range or area within which an agreement is satisfactory to both parties involved in negotiation, typically between employer and employee or buyer and seller.
